Comparing the 2026 BMW iX (from $75,150) with the 2025 Hyundai Kona Electric (from $32,975). The iX offers 279 miles of range while the Kona Electric offers 200 miles.

The Hyundai Kona Electric starts at $32,975, undercutting the BMW iX ($75,150) by about $42,000.
In its longest-range configuration the BMW iX covers up to 364 miles, 103 more than the Hyundai Kona Electric's maximum of 261. At a DC fast charger, the BMW iX goes from 10-80% in about 34 minutes vs 43 for the Hyundai Kona Electric.
The BMW iX offers 77.9 cu ft of cargo space vs 63.7 for the Hyundai Kona Electric. The Hyundai Kona Electric is also 24 inches shorter than the BMW iX, which makes it easier to park.
Bottom line: pick the BMW iX if you want the quickest acceleration, or the Hyundai Kona Electric if you want the most for your money.
